The journey of normal French Bulldog colors dates back again to 1897, when brindle reigned supreme as the sole acknowledged color. This transformed in 1911, pursuing a revision of breed standards, which then bundled many different colors and styles for example fawn, cream, and piebald.

Inside the fascinating environment of French Bulldogs, ‘unique’ colors and designs make reference to All those not recognized or approved by the American Kennel Club (AKC). These exceptional hues and types, when captivating, do not conform to the normal breed specifications set for exhibit ring competitions.
